Southeast Asia is enduring a brutal, record-setting heat wave

A dangerous and record-smashing heat wave is lodged over Southeast Asia, closing schools, testing power grids, and causing a notable spike in heat-related illnesses and deaths.

For several days, temperatures have soared anywhere up to 100 to 120 degrees from India to the Philippines, while 90s have swelled northward into Japan.
